Topography (elevation, slope, aspect) directly affects microclimate, soil development, water availability, and habitat diversity - which determines what organisms can survive and where they distribute themselves. While patterns of residence (human settlement) are influenced by topography, this is a secondary effect through how organisms (including humans) respond to the physical landscape.
